Fixes (by The_Bob):

- Fixed random freeze on win8/10
- Fixed crash on mercs entering sector
- Fixed crash when using cover display (del/end)
- Fixed attachment popup showing incompatible attachments (crash/freeze/confusion on clicking the option)
- Fixed attachment popup positioning
- Fixed LBE contents corruption/deletion
- Fixed access violation (out of array bounds) in interrupt code
- Fixed a bunch of random old stuff
- Got the project to build on VS2015
- Improved popup class handling of grayed out options
- Improved performance of get item assignment check (added by Flugente)
- Added Ctrl+Space bind for testing/fixing broken LBE contents
